  • Patent number: 8048468
    Abstract: Provided are a glyceride oil composition derived from a fish oil and a preparation method thereof. The composition includes doc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) and docosapentaenoic acid (DPA) with a content of 45 to 95% by weight and e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A) with a content of 0.001 to 13% by weight among constituent fatty acids, and a saturated fatty acid having 16 to 18 carbon atoms, which is bonded at 1- and 3-positions, with a content of 0.001 to 5% by weight among constituent fatty acids, in which a weight ratio of docosahexaenoic acid (DHA)/docosapentaenoic acid (DPA) is 0.5 to 8 and a weight ratio of docosahexaenoic acid (DHA)/e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A) is 3.5 to 15. The glyceride oil composition derived from fish oil has nutritional and physiological superiority due to containing a great amount of polyunsaturated fatty acids such as DHA and DPA in a form of glyceride, and can minimize disadvantages of EPA such as inhibition of ?-6 fatty acid metabolism by containing a low amount of EPA.

  • Patent number: 8022453
    Abstract: An image sensor including a first region where a pad is to be formed, and a second region where a light-receiving element is to be formed. A pad is formed over a substrate of the first region. A passivation layer is formed over the substrate of the first and second regions to expose a portion of the pad. A color filter is formed over the passivation layer of the second region. A microlens is formed over the color filter. A bump is formed over the pad. A protective layer is formed between the bump and the pad to expose the portion of the pad.

  • Publication number: 20080259251
    Abstract: A green emitting phosphor of the following composition: Sr1-xBaxGa2S4:yEu2+, where 0.01?x?0.9 and 0.01?y?0.1. The green emitting phosphor can be applied to a light emitting device due to having light emitting peaks at a short wavelength of 522 to 535 nm and improved color coordinate characteristics.

  • Patent number: 7294524
    Abstract: A method for fabricating an image sensor including a first region, which is a light receiving region, and a second region, which is a pad region, includes forming a metal line in the second region over a substrate structure comprising a photodiode, forming a passivation layer over the substrate structure, selectively etching the passivation layer to form an opening exposing the metal line where a pad contact is to be formed, forming a first over coating layer (OCL1) in the first region while forming an over coating layer (OCL) plug over the opening in the second region, forming color filters, a second over coating layer (OCL2), and micro lenses in sequential order over the OCL1 in the first region, forming a photoresist pattern exposing the OCL plug, performing an etch-back process to remove the OCL plug, and removing the photoresist pattern.
